The baby name Aegaeus is a Male name , 4 syllables long and is pronounced /iːˈgeɪəs/ (ee-GAY-us),/ˈiːdʒiəs/ (EE-jee-əs).
Aegaeus is Greek in Origin.
Aegaeus is the Latinized form of Ancient Greek Aigaios (Αἰγαῖος), an epithet meaning 'Aegean' or 'of Aigai,' and by extension 'of the sea.' In Greek cult and poetry it is especially attached to Poseidon (Poseidon Aegaeus), evoking the god’s dominion over the Aegean waters. The underlying root is debated: some relate it to place-names Aigai/Aegae found across the Greek world; others connect it to the Aegean Sea itself, yielding a general sense of sea-born or sea-linked.
Classical usage overlaps with Aegeus/Aigeus (Αἰγεύς), the mythic king of Athens and father of Theseus, whose name is sometimes confused with or rendered as Aegaeus in Latin sources. Documented variants include Aigaios, Aegeus, Aigeus, and the literary Egeus; the feminine forms Aegaea/Aigea also occur. Modern usage is rare, resurfacing mainly in Renaissance and 19th-century neoclassical revivals and in contemporary scholarly or poetic contexts.
